Перед вами не список на все случаи жизни, а лишь рекомендации, которые стоит учесть при создании карты событий и таксономии данных.
Проверенные практики настройки продуктовой аналитики
Обязательно ознакомьтесь с нашими отраслевыми гайдами по передовым практикам, они помогут вам внедрить Amplitude и быстро начать извлекать информацию. Эти руководства следуют нашему процессу измерения из трех этапов.
Эффективный процесс измерения состоит из трех ключевых шагов: настройка метрик продукта (setting product metrics), выстраивание таксономии данных (designing a data taxonomy) и внедрение таксономии в продукт (instrumenting your taxonomy). Такой процесс гарантирует отсутствие лишней перегрузки событиями, что позволит избавить таксономию от засорения лишними данными, не представляющими ценности для вашей команды. Кроме того, благодаря такому процессу вы не перегрузите таксономию так, что она перестанет отвечать на ключевые метрики вашей команды.
В наших руководствах по лучшим отраслевым практикам приводятся кейсы и бизнес-вопросы, рекомендуемая таксономия и дополнительный дашборд, которыми можно пользоваться для собственных измерений. Их цель состоит в том, чтобы сделать в продукте ощутимый прирост конверсии, рост удержания и добиться результатов. Вся информация в руководствах тщательно подобрана под конкретные потребности вашей отрасли.
На данный момент мы предлагаем гайды для компаний из следующих секторов:
- E-commerce
- Финтех
- Публикации
- Медиа-стриминг
- B2B
Пожалуйста изучите эти гайды, чтобы узнать примеры лучших практик полной реализации и подробные дополнительные советы по выстраивании таксономии, приведенные ниже.
E-Commerce / Маркетплейсы
Убедитесь, что в критический путь (critical flow) включено каждое критическое событие (critical event) и для каждого из них используются одни и те же ключевые свойства события. В Amplitude можно сделать свойство константным, чтобы увидеть число конверсий в воронке.
Вот несколько примеров ключевых свойств событий: Product ID, Category ID, Cart ID, Transaction ID, Order ID, Promotion ID, Campaign ID.
Если ваши клиенты могут сохранять какие-то платежные или контактные данные, отправьте событие об их использовании при оформлении заказа. Создайте кастомное событие, в которое будут включены все адреса и выставления счетов. Далее при анализе воронки воспользуйтесь кастомным событием для этапа выставления счета и заполнения адреса.
События и свойства событий
Событие | Свойства события |
---|---|
Product Viewed / Товаров просмотрено | |
Product Added to Cart / Товаров добавлено в корзину | Объедините всю информацию об артикуле в одном свойстве события так, чтобы вся информация об артикуле хранилась в массиве, разделенном запятыми [“Product ID”, “Color”, “Quantity”] |
View Cart / Просмотрена корзина | |
Checkout - Started / Заказ - начат | |
Checkout - Added Shipping Address / Заказ - заполнен адрес доставки | |
Checkout - Added Billing Address / Заказ - добавлен счет | |
Checkout - Added Payment / Заказ - заполнены данные оплаты | |
Checkout - Completed / Заказ - выполнен | В этом событии мы советуем отслеживать свойство ‘Order Size’. Подсчитывать общее количество товаров в корзине по свойствам - хорошая практика, потому что это позволяет сегментировать события по величине корзины”. Это свойство важно, потому что вы не сможете суммировать продукты из массива. |
Saved Billing / Сохранен счет | |
Saved Address / Сохранен адрес | |
PageView - Product Category / Страница - Категория товара | Отследить показы можно по массиву товаров на странице. Также нужно дополнительно к номеру страницы, с которой осуществлялся поиск, отслеживать общее количество товаров на этой странице. Это поможет понять нужные ли товары получают пользователи на первых двух страницах поиска. Page = [1,2,3,4….] |
PageView - Product Detail / Страница - Карточка товараl | Свойство события ‘Source’ покажет страницу, на которой был пользователь перед тем, как перешел к карточке товара. Source = PageView - Product Category |
Свойства пользователя
- Purchase Date (Дата покупки)
- Attribution Data (organic vs. campaign) (Данные атрибуции)
- Total Revenue Spent (Общий объем покупок)
- Promotions Used (Участие в акциях)
- Total Number of Orders (Общее количество заказов)
- Total Number of Favorites (Общее количество избранного)
- Total Number of Saved Items (Общее количество сохраненных товаров)
- Categories Used (Востребованные категории)
- Brand Purchased (Покупаемые бренды)
Социальные сети
События | Свойства события | Примечание |
---|---|---|
Send Chat / Отправил сообщение | Message ID — ID сообщения | Если пользователи вдвоем делают действие и вы хотите отслеживать события в профилях обоих, отправьте событие для каждого из них. События могут быть инициированы первоначальным действием. |
Receive Chat / Получил сообщение | Message ID — ID сообщения | — // — |
Total Swipes / Всего свайпов | В случае с очень частыми событиями (например, общее количество сообщений или пролистываний) отправьте одно событие в конце сессии и сохраните общее количество как значение свойства. | |
Any General Event / Any General Event (любое общее событие) | Duration (Продолжительность): Отслеживаем время, затраченное пользователем на действие Impression tracking (Отслеживание показов): массив всех элементов, которые были на странице Отслеживание показов (Исходная страница): Где был пользователь до этого события |
Свойства пользователя
- Total Number of Followers (Общее количество подписчиков)
- Total Number Following (Общее количество подписок)
- Gamification Status (Статус геймификации)
- Total Number of Groups (Общее количество групп)
- Total Number of Communities (Общее количество сообществ)
- Total Number of Chats (Общее количество диалогов)
- Social Integrations (Интеграция с соцсетями)
- Attribution Data (organic, campaign) (Данные атрибуции)
Медиа
События и свойства событий
События | Свойства события | Примечание |
---|---|---|
Send Chat / Отправил сообщение | Message ID — ID сообщения | Если пользователи вдвоем делают действие и вы хотите отслеживать события в профилях обоих, отправьте событие для каждого из них. События могут быть инициированы первоначальным действием. |
Receive Chat / Получил сообщение | Message ID — ID сообщения | — // — |
‘Heartbeat’ Events / События “сердцебиения” | Если пользователь смотрит видео, отправьте событие сердцебиения. Преимущество этого в том, что не придется корректировать время время окончания сеанса и в целом у вас будет совокупное количество сеансов просмотров. Недостаток в том, что может увеличиться объем событий. Например: Если пользователь смотрит видео или играет в игру, отправляйте события примерно каждые пять минут. | |
Any General Event / Любое общее событие (PageView - HomePage, VideoCategory) | Source Page — Страница откуда пришел Destination Page — Страница куда переходит Duration — Длительность Impression tracking — Отслеживание показов: массив всех элементов, которые были на странице |
Свойства пользователя
- Attribution Data (organic, campaign) — Данные атрибуции (organic vs. campaign)
- Total Hours Watched — Общее количество часов, затраченных на просмотр
- Total Articles Read, Favorited, etc. — Общее количество прочитанных статей, добавленных в избранное и так далее
B2B
Примечание: Мы советуем настроить отчеты на уровне учетной записи. Это доступно на аккаунтах типа Enterprise с приобретенным аддоном Accounts.
События
- Событие метрики компании: Одно ежедневное событие со свойствами для всей компании/организации/группы.
События пользователей
- User ID for Company Level Metrics — ID пользователя для метрик на уровне компании
- total X created — Всего создано Х
- total users — Общее количество пользователей
- Account billing — Счет аккаунта
- company-level metrics — Метрики на уровне компании
Gaming
События с свойства событий
События | Свойства события | Примечание |
---|---|---|
Game start / Игра запущена | Одно ежедневное событие со свойствами для все компании/организации/группы | |
Purchase Made / Сделана покупка | Total Spent - In App Purchase — Всего потрачено на покупки внутри приложения Duration — Продолжительность | |
Add Items to Cart / Добавлен товар в корзину | Total Spent - In App Purchase — Всего потрачено на покупки внутри приложения Duration — Продолжительность | |
Ad Revenue / Доход с рекламы | Срабатывает если у пользователя появляется реклама | |
Impressions Event for Ad / Событие показа рекламы | ||
Ad Clicked / Переход по рекламе | ID игры | Если пользователи вдвоем делают действие и вы хотите отслеживать события в профилях обоих, отправьте событие для каждого из них. События могут быть инициированы первоначальным действием. ‘Send Chat’ + ‘Receive Chat’ |
Send Chat / Отправлено сообщение | ID игры | — // — |
Свойства пользователя
- Attribution Data (organic, campaign) (Данные атрибуции)
- Current Level (Текущий уровень)
- Games Played (Игр сыграно)
- Total Number of Games Played (Общее количество сыгранных игр)
- Tokens / Currency (Токены/валюта)
- Total Spent (Всего затрачено)
- Items Purchased (Предметов куплено)
- Game or User Name (Имя игры или пользователя)
- Current Rank (Текущий ранг)
- Special Features Used (e.g. avatar) (Использовано специальных функций (вроде аватара))
- Games Won (Игр выиграно)
- Games Lost (Игр проиграно)
- Top 10 Games (Топ 10 игр)
- Most Popular Games (Наиболее популярные игры)
- Days Active to Date (Дней активности на данный момент)
- Days Playing to Date (Дней активности на данный момент)
- Days Since Last Game Played (Дней с последнего захода в игру)
- Days Since First Game Played (Дней с первого захода в игру)
Примеры карт событий и таксономий
Чтобы помочь лучше разобраться и представить таксономию событий мы собрали пару примеров:
Шаблон Google Documents для использования
Мы надеемся, что эта статья помогла вам лучше разобраться в том, как настроить события в системе продуктовой аналитики. Если используете тариф Growth или Enterprise, не стесняйтесь обращаться к своему Success-менеджеру, если вам нужна помощь по настройке таксономии. Если у вас бесплатный тариф и вы хотите обсудить Event Taxonomy, посетите наше Amplitude Community.